The city of Kenansville is located in the state of North Carolina in Duplin County and has a population of 1,165 as reported by the census of 2010. Kenansville, North Carolina Climate and Weather
Current Weather in Kenansville
In the month of December, Kenansville experiences an average high temperature of 58 degrees Fahrenheit. Low temperaturs in December are usually about 35 degrees with an average rainfall of 3.23 inches. The seasonal climate varies in Kenansville with daytime temperatures averaging 88 degrees in the summer, and 57 degrees in the winter months. Visitors can also expect Kenansville to receive an average of 3.4 inches of rainfall per/month during winter months and 5.86 inches of rainfall per/month in the summer months. The temperature has been known to get as high as 104 degrees in the summer and as low as -4 degrees in the winter so visitors planning a vacation to Kenansville should check the weather forecast to determine proper attire prior to departure. Cliffs of the Neuse State Park - Seven Springs, Cliffs of the Neuse State Park is a North Carolina state park in Wayne County, North Carolina in the US. It is located near Seven Springs, North Carolina and covers 892 acres along the southern banks of the Neuse River. It has a swimming area, camp sites, hiking trails, fishing areas, and picnic areas. The park's museum features exhibits about the geology and natural history of the cliffs and the park.

CSS Neuse State Historic Site - Kinston, The CSS Neuse was an ironclad warship of the Confederate States Navy during the American Civil War. The remains of the ship can now be seen at an exhibit in Kinston, North Carolina as the CSS Neuse State Historic Site and Governor Caswell Memorial. The ship is listed on the National Register of Historic Places.
